How to Maximize Efficiency of Fertilizers in a Forest Tree Nursery


The essentiality of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ium was reviewed. Knowledge of the reaction of these nutrients in soil is a prerequisite to efficient use of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ium fertilizers in forest nurseries. Notwithstanding economic considerations, biological requirements are strong determinants of nursery fertilization procedures.
